The dialogue of university representatives from the Shanghai Cooperation Organization countries took place last week in Beijing.

The conference was attended by representatives from universities in Kazakhstan, China, Russia, and Uzbekistan. The meeting was hosted by the North China Electric Power University, and Lu Jinsun, Head of the Special Committee on Carbon Peak and Carbon Neutrality of the China Society for Electric Power Development, also delivered a report.

In his speech, Toraighyrov University Rector Nurlan Medetov emphasized the development of the Pavlodar region and outlined its key growth areas: industry, mechanical engineering, and both traditional and innovative energy sectors. The ToU Rector highlighted the university’s role in preparing specialists for the energy sector and called on partner universities to strengthen cooperation and implement joint projects.

The ToU delegation visited an international center engaged in the production of building materials, integrated photovoltaics, construction projects, as well as environmental protection and restoration initiatives.
